Understanding Oceanic Energies & Their Impact

The ocean is a complex system of interacting energies, from the visible movement of waves and tides to the more subtle electromagnetic fields generated by saltwater and marine life. For centuries, coastal communities have intuitively understood these energies and their influence on human health and wellbeing. Traditional practices, such as ceremonial bathing and the use of seawater for medicinal purposes, reflect this deep-seated knowledge. Modern science is beginning to validate these ancient understandings, demonstrating the positive effects of ocean exposure on physiological processes like heart rate variability, immune function, and stress hormone levels. The rhythmic sound of waves, for instance, has been shown to induce a state of relaxation, similar to that achieved through meditation. Furthermore, the negative ions present in sea air are believed to enhance mood and cognitive function.

The Neuroscience of Oceanic Wellbeing

The positive effects of ocean exposure aren’t merely subjective experiences; they’re rooted in measurable changes in brain activity. Studies have shown that exposure to blue spaces—oceans, lakes, rivers—activates the parasympathetic nervous system, responsible for the ‘rest and digest’ response. This leads to a reduction in stress hormones like cortisol and an increase in feel-good neurotransmitters like dopamine and serotonin. Furthermore, the fractal patterns found in waves and coastlines have been shown to captivate our attention in a way that reduces mental fatigue and promotes a sense of wonder. This inherent aesthetic appeal of oceanic landscapes contributes significantly to their therapeutic value.
